(require hy.contrib.anaphoric) | |
(require pyherc.macros) | |
(import [functools [partial]] | |
[itertools [chain]] | |
[pyherc.generators.level.partitioners.section [new-section | |
left-edge right-edge | |
section-corners | |
section-level | |
section-width | |
section-height]]) | |
(defn binary-space-partitioning [level-size room-min-size rng] | |
"create a new partitioner" | |
(fn [level] | |
"partition a level" | |
(let [[section (new-section #t(0 0) level-size level rng)]] | |
(partition-section level-size room-min-size rng section)))) | |
(defn partition-section [level-size room-min-size rng section] | |
"recursively partition a section" | |
(let [[split-directions (possible-splits room-min-size section)]] | |
(if (= (len split-directions) 0) | |
[section] | |
(let [[direction (.choice rng split-directions)] | |
[new-sections (split-section section direction room-min-size rng)]] | |
(.from-iterable chain (ap-map (partition-section level-size | |
room-min-size | |
rng | |
it) | |
new-sections)))))) | |
(defn possible-splits [room-min-size section] | |
"produce list of possible ways to split a section" | |
(let [[directions []]] | |
(if (< (* 2 (first room-min-size)) (section-width section)) | |
(.append directions :horizontal)) | |
(if (< (* 2 (second room-min-size)) (section-height section)) | |
(.append directions :vertical)) | |
directions)) | |
(defn split-section [section direction room-min-size rng] | |
"split section to a given direction" | |
(cond [(= direction :horizontal) (split-horizontally section | |
room-min-size | |
rng)] | |
[(= direction :vertical) (split-vertically section | |
room-min-size | |
rng)])) | |
(defn split-horizontally [section room-min-size rng] | |
(let [[level (section-level section)] | |
[corners (section-corners section)] | |
[cut-point (.randint rng | |
(+ (left-edge section) | |
(first room-min-size)) | |
(- (right-edge section) | |
(first room-min-size)))] | |
[section₀ (new-section (first corners) | |
#t(cut-point | |
(y-coordinate (second corners))) | |
level rng)] | |
[section₁ (new-section #t((+ cut-point 1) | |
(y-coordinate (first corners))) | |
(second corners) | |
level rng)]] | |
[section₀ section₁])) | |
(defn split-vertically [section room-min-size rng] | |
(assert false)) |
